DIE HARD 2: DIE HARDER
FILM ONLY REVIEW
This is the second of four Die Hard films. The main character John McClane, of course, played by Bruce Willis.
John McClane is a tough, brave, strong and ready for anything sort of guy - as we saw in the first Die Hard!!
His story:
John McClane was once a New York City police officer.
His wife Holly played by Bonnie Bedelia finds a job in California and decided leave to start a life with their 2 daughters despite McClane's decision to stay in New York City to fight crime.
After becoming a hero when saving a plethora of people at the Nagasaki building from terrorists in the original movie "Die Hard", John McClane moved to California to be with his family and became an officer for the L.A.P.D.
Like Die Hard; Die Hard 2 begins on Christmas Eve in an airport, though this is in Dulles airport in Washington D.C. as opposed to L.A. International Airport.
The Story:
McClane is waiting for his wife to fly in , but his Christmas does not start off so good, when his car is towed away for parking in a tow away zone.
When a group of unauthorized individuals walk into a baggage area which is restricted and usually locked off.
McClane, using his intelligence, goes in after them to make sure that they are not going to engage in foul play and a war with guns starts between him and the enemies.
Terrorists have invaded Dulles Airport and have plotted to take it over.
Their reason: An international criminal named General Ramon Esperanza played by Franco Nero, is flying into Dulles airport. He has been detained and is en route to be tried for drug-related crimes.
The terrorist action is being lead by former Army Colonel Stewart played by William Sadler whom plays a mean character who has no interest for anything but to cause hysteria and chaos.
The terrorists seize theairport and thousands of holiday travelers are being held hostage inside their planes which have been told to circle up above. In one of those planes is John's wife, Holly.
It's a race against time, the fuel is running low for the planes up above; but Dulles airport has one good thing on their side and that is McClane.
The one thing that stands in McClane's way, Airport police chief Lorenzo Carmine played by Dennis Franz.
Carmine plays the jealous and stubborn cop who doesn't want to listen to reason or to allow some police officer who not under his jurisdiction to take over the leadership.
With McClane's wit and tactics will he be able to sidetrack Stewarts plans?
Does the fuel last in those planes?
Does Holly make it down?
What did I think:
I liked the way that this film used the idea of the media pushing to get a good story. As opposed to Die Hard, there were 2 key reporters. Sam Koleman from WKCH whom is at Dulles airport from the time when McClane put the first terrorist he encountered in the body bag, whom ends up being an accomplice to McClane's success in defeating the terrorists. The other was the same annoying reporter, Dick Thornton whom angered me a little in Die Hard, but really got me mad in this version.
Throughout all 131 minutes of this film I was mesmerised with it; as well as the thrill element there was also plenty of humour. I thought that it was excellentfor a sequel, which very often are a dissapointment.
All in all I thought that was a great action film, anyone who enjoyed the first Die Hard film will undoubtedly enjoy the second, and whoever enjoys Bruce Willis, will definitely get a kick out of Die Hard 2 - Fasten your seatbelt, it might be a bumpy ride!!
